Kakaca [onomatopoetic to sound root kr̥, cf. note on gala; Sanskrit krakaca] a saw Thag 445; Ja IV 30; V 52; VI 261; Sv I 212; in simile — ūpama ovāda M I 129. Another simile of the saw (a man sawing a tree) is found at Paṭis I 171, quoted and referred to at Vism 280, 281. -khaṇḍa fragment or bit of saw Ja I 321; -danta tooth of a saw, Sv I 37 (kakaca-danta-pantiyaṃ kīḷamāna).
